Donald Trump
Donald John Trump (born June 14, 1946) is the 45th and current president of the United States. Before entering politics, he was a businessman and television personality. Trump was born and raised in Queens, a borough of New York City, and received a bachelor's degree in economics from the Wharton School. He took charge of his family's real-estate business in 1971, renamed it The Trump Organization, and expanded its operations from Queens and Brooklyn into Manhattan. The company built or renovated skyscrapers, hotels, casinos, and golf courses. Trump later started various side ventures, mostly by licensing his name. He produced and hosted The Apprentice, a reality television series, from 2003 to 2015. As of 2019, Forbes estimated his net worth to be $3.1 billion

New England Journal of Medicine calls for US leaders to be voted out over COVID-19 handling

WALTHAM, Mass. - A prestigious medical journal published a scathing editorial this week calling for leaders in the federal government to be voted out in November due to the coronavirus pandemic, stating they “have taken a crisis and turned it into a tragedy.”New England Journal of Medicine, which has remained nonpartisan in its 200-year history, did not mention President Donald Trump or Democratic nominee Joe Biden by name, but urged Americans to vote “current political leaders” out of office.President Donald Trump removes his mask upon return to the White House from Walter Reed National Military Medical Center on Oct.
